site stats

Sql server remove partition scheme

WebAfter dropping the hypotheticals, remove the _hypothetical partitions_ as well (after merging them back to the primary as in ON([PRIMARY],[PRIMARY], etc) TO FIND THEM try the code below [code} Sp_help ‘tablename’ --DROP INDEX ON for all rogue indexes. DROP PARTITION SCHEME [] DROP PARTITION FUNCTION [] {code} WebSep 24, 2008 · RANGE ( boundary_value) must be an existing boundary value, into which the values from the dropped partition are merged. The filegroup that originally held boundary_value is removed from the partition scheme unless it is used by a remaining partition, or is marked with the NEXT USED property.

How to automate Table Partitioning in SQL Server

WebSyntax ALTER PARTITION SCHEME partition_scheme NEXT USED [ filegroup] [;] Key file_group A single filegroup to be designated as NEXT USED. Must already exist. The filegroup does not need to be empty, one file group may be used for multiple partitions. To remove the NEXT USED allocation, run the command without specifying any filegroup. … WebAug 17, 2024 · Users can check actual partition range, Partition Function name, and Partition Schema name with the help of above T-SQL. The above query helps when the user wants to find identify the partition ... pictures of garbage: the gipsy magna https://patriaselectric.com

How to remove the SQL Server Partitioning implemented …

WebJul 29, 2013 · All partition-functions and -schemes were deleted I queried the dm views for unused filegroups like this: SELECT * FROM sys.filegroups fg LEFT OUTER JOIN sysfilegroups sfg ON fg.name = sfg.groupname LEFT OUTER JOIN sysfiles f ON sfg.groupid = f.groupid LEFT OUTER JOIN sys.indexes i ON fg.data_space_id = i.data_space_id … WebOct 20, 2015 · DROP PARTITION SCHEME [PartitionSchemeName_PS] GO DROP PARTITION FUNCTION [PartitionfunctionName_PF] GO Drop the Dummy Index DROP … WebSep 21, 2024 · A Partition Scheme: A partition Scheme is based on the Partition Function and determines on which physical structures rows belonging to each partition will be placed. This is achieved by mapping such rows to filegroups. Listing 2 shows the code for creating a Partition Scheme. pictures of garbage bins

How do I delete a partition scheme in SQL Server?

Category:Switching Out Table Partitions in SQL Server: A Walkthrough

Tags:Sql server remove partition scheme

Sql server remove partition scheme

Database table partitioning in SQL Server - SQL Shack

WebA partition scheme is a database object that maps the partitions returned by a partition function to filegroups. The following statement creates a partition scheme that maps the partitions returned by order_by_year_function to filegroups: WebAug 6, 2024 · The Steps: DROP INDEX CIDX_X on X /* drop the clustered */. CREATE CLUSTERED INDEX CIDX_X1 ON X (col1) ON [PRIMARY] /* Create another clustered index on the table to free it from the partitioning scheme; Here, the “ON [primary]” part is key to removing the partition scheme from the table ! DROP PARTITION SCHEME PS1.

Sql server remove partition scheme

Did you know?

WebMar 27, 2024 · If you don't want that (and if you're on SQL 2016+), truncate table takes a partition argument. Either way you do it, you should probably remove the old partition boundary. – Ben Thul Mar 27, 2024 at 13:47 @BenThul - you were right. truncate table is not enough, I have to remove the old partition boundary too. WebDec 30, 2024 · Applies to: SQL Server ( SQL Server 2016 (13.x) through current version) Specifies the partitions to truncate or from which all rows are removed. If the table is not partitioned, the WITH PARTITIONS argument will generate an error. If the WITH PARTITIONS clause is not provided, the entire table will be truncated.

WebMay 13, 2008 · Removing a file group from a partition scheme Removing a file group from a partition scheme Archived Forums 361-380 > SQL Server Database Engine Question 0 Sign in to vote I am trying to remove a filegroup after conducting a purge. used the "Merge Range" on the partition fuction and removed the physical file from the filegroup. WebJan 31, 2024 · SELECT * FROM sys.partition_schemes; SELECT * FROM sys.partition_functions; 0 rows... no partitioning objects left in the database UPDATE STATISTICS for all objects in the database no effect Checks for indexes on filegroup: SELECT * FROM sys.data_spaces ds INNER JOIN sys.indexes i ON ds.data_space_id = …

WebDec 29, 2024 · RANGE ( boundary_value) must be an existing boundary value, of the partition to be dropped. This argument removes the filegroup that originally held boundary_value from the partition scheme unless a remaining partition uses it, … WebIf you want to remove the partition boundary the MERGE statement will do that:- ALTER PARTITION FUNCTION PartitionFunctionName() MERGE RANGE (Boundary Value); GO If …

WebJan 20, 2024 · TRUNCATE TABLE MyTable WITH (PARTITIONS (3)); TRUNCATE TABLE MyTable WITH (PARTITIONS (1)); which will remove all rows from partition from the files associated with FG_2024_08 and FG_2024_10. That works great, and now I have an empty file, but SQL Server doesn't allow to drop: It says it still in use.

WebJul 7, 2024 · Table Partitioning in SQL Server – Step by Step. Partitioning in SQL Server task is divided into four steps: Create a File Group. Add Files to File Group. Create a Partition Function with Ranges. Create a Partition … pictures of garden city sc after ianWebSep 16, 2024 · You can't drop partition schemes or functions that are in use. USE tempdb CREATE PARTITION FUNCTION yourmom ( INT ) AS RANGE LEFT FOR VALUES ( 10, 20, … tophomeeWebWe need to remove partitioning from the tables, remove the four files and filegroups, and then move all data to the PRIMARY filegroup without losing any data. Sample Database – Start by creating a test database with a few … pictures of garden fish pondsWebI have a SQL Server database which contains two tables -- Acks and Logs. These two tables are related in logic but not in a relational database way. Basically, every message that comes in gets saved in the Log table and, if our server acknowledges it, then that ack gets stored in the Ack table.. We are storing around 5 million Acks and 3 million Logs a day. top home design software programsWebDec 29, 2024 · The following permissions can be used to execute ALTER PARTITION SCHEME: ALTER ANY DATASPACE permission. This permission defaults to members of … pictures of gardeningWebDROP PARTITION SCHEME. Drop a partition function from the current database. Syntax DROP PARTITION SCHEME ps_name [;] Key ps_name The partition scheme to drop. This … pictures of garden sprayerWebApr 4, 2014 · Vertical table partitioning is mostly used to increase SQL Server performance especially in cases where a query retrieves all columns from a table that contains a number of very wide text or BLOB columns. In this case to reduce access times the BLOB columns can be split to its own table. top home generator companies